feat(opencode): Venice Add automatic variant generation for Venice models (#12106)

This commit is contained in:
dpuyosa 2026-02-12 03:21:29 +01:00 committed by GitHub
parent 81ca2df6ad
commit bf5a01edd9
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-401,6 +401,8 @@ export namespace ProviderTransform {
// https://v5.ai-sdk.dev/providers/ai-sdk-providers/xai
case "@ai-sdk/deepinfra":
// https://v5.ai-sdk.dev/providers/ai-sdk-providers/deepinfra
case "venice-ai-sdk-provider":
// https://docs.venice.ai/overview/guides/reasoning-models#reasoning-effort
case "@ai-sdk/openai-compatible":
return Object.fromEntries(WIDELY_SUPPORTED_EFFORTS.map((effort) => [effort, { reasoningEffort: effort }]))